Acte uniforme révisé portant organisation des sûretés › Title 5 › Chapter 2

SECTION 10

The deed appointing the agent may provide for the conditions under which the agent may employ a third party to accomplish, under his responsibility, his mission. In that case, the creditor may take action directly against such third party. The said deed may equally provide for conditions under which the agent may be replaced where he neglects his mission or where he puts into jeopardy the interests entrusted in him, or again, where collective proceedings have been instituted against him. In the absence of any contractual provisions to this effect, the creditormay, in the above-cited circumstances, pray the competent court to urgently appoint a temporary agent or have the agent replaced. Where the agent is replaced either as a result of a contractual clause or by order of court, all the rights and all the shares he held on behalf of the creditor shall be transferred as of right and with no other formality to the new agent.
